there doesn't seem to exist a decent syntax highlighting editor for PHP 
neither on Unix nor on Windows. The problem is, that this would mean for the 
editor to:
- normally highlight HTML
- highlight PHP between scripting tags like <? ?> or <?php ?>
- (maybe) start highlighting HTML again when inside a PHP section quotes are  
  used (so that echo lines are highlighted as HTML)
I ask, because my brother said, that all people in their company would like 
to switch to linux if they only could use e.g. Quanta+ with a decent PHP 
highlighting (which would make me very happy :). Has anybody worked on this? 
Is something like this hard to do?
